What is an eGPU?
An eGPU is an external graphics processing unit that can be connected to a laptop or desktop computer to enhance its graphics capabilities. By bypassing the integrated graphics, an eGPU provides a significant boost in performance, allowing for smoother gaming, video editing, and graphics-intensive applications.

DIY eGPU Setup 1.35 is a paid, proprietary software developed by Nando4 (available on eGPU.io ) designed to fix resource allocation issues like Error 12 on older laptops. There is no legitimate "free patched" version; files claiming this on sites like Google Drive are often high-risk malware or outdated "cracks" that can compromise your system. 🛠️ Software Overview
DIY eGPU Setup 1.35 acts as a pre-boot environment to configure your laptop’s PCIe resources before Windows loads.
Primary Function: Resolves "Error 12: This device cannot find enough free resources that it can use". Key Features:
PCI Compaction: Reallocates memory addresses to make room for the external GPU.
dGPU Disabling: Disables the internal dedicated GPU to free up system resources.
Link Speed Control: Manually sets PCIe Gen1 or Gen2 speeds for stability.
Hot-plugging Support: Facilitates eGPU detection without requiring a specific boot order. ⚠️ Security Warning: "Free Patched" Risks
Searching for "free patched" or "cracked" versions of this software exposes you to several dangers:
Malware: Most "free" downloads found on file-sharing sites are bundled with Trojans or Ransomware.
System Corruption: Because this software operates at a low level (pre-boot), a modified version can permanently corrupt your bootloader or BIOS settings.
Lack of Support: The official version includes expert support from the creator, which is crucial given the high technical difficulty of eGPU setups. 🏗️ How to Set Up a DIY eGPU
